A GALASHIELS man has been remanded in custody after being accused of punching and stamping on his partner.
Twenty two year old Jonathan Barnes - who gave an address in Croft Street - denies assaulting the woman to her injury at a house in Galashiels on Tuesday, August 7.
Bail was refused at Selkirk Sheriff Court and Barnes was locked up until the case next calls for an intermediate trial hearing on August 27.
The trial date has been set for September 13.
